These are great if you need to build cheap system. The onboard audio doesn`t perform well under win98 but works great in winME uless you get a better driver
Motherboards are OEM packed, brand new, never used, come with driver CD and cables
-> Supports Socket A (Socket 462) AMD Duron up to 800MHz
-> Supports Socket A (Socket 462) AMD Athlon T-Bird up to 1.3GHz (200MHz Bus)
-> VIA KT133 chipset
-> Three PCI slots
-> One AGP slot (supports 4X AGP cards)
-> Three DIMM sockets (supports PC100/PC133)
-> Integrated VIA sound
-> Two PS/2 ports, Two USB ports, One Serial port,
-> One Parallel port, Mic. In/Audio in/Line in
-> Micro-ATX size
